Is The Handpulled Noodle clean?
The Handpulled Noodle is currently Grade A from NYC Department of Health and Mental Hygiene (DOHMH), from an inspection on March 27, 2025. Inspectors wrote up 2 critical violations β the kind most directly linked to foodborne illness.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ean π.

How New York grades restaurants
New York City health inspectors score violations in points, and lower is better: 0β13 points earns an A, 14β27 a B, and 28 or more a C. Every restaurant is inspected at least once a year, and the letter has to be posted in the window. A restaurant that scores 14 or more on the first inspection of a cycle does not get a letter right away β it stays βGrade Pendingβ until a re-inspection settles it, which is why some spots here show an hourglass instead of a letter.
